[docs] @dataclass class ValidationSettings: """ Represents the settings for RO-Crate validation. It includes the following attributes: """ #: The URI of the RO-Crate rocrate_uri: URI # pyright: ignore[reportRedeclaration] #: The relative root path of the RO-Crate rocrate_relative_root_path: Path | None = None # Profile settings #: The path to the profiles profiles_path: Path = DEFAULT_PROFILES_PATH #: The path to the extra profiles extra_profiles_path: Path | None = None #: The profile identifier to validate against profile_identifier: str = DEFAULT_PROFILE_IDENTIFIER #: Flag to enable profile inheritance # Use the `enable_profile_inheritance` flag with caution: disable inheritance only if the # target validation profile is fully self-contained and does not rely on definitions # from inherited profiles (e.g., entities defined upstream). For modularization # purposes, some base entities and properties are defined in the base RO-Crate # profile and are intentionally not redefined in specialized profiles; they are # required for validations targeting those specializations and therefore cannot be skipped. # Nevertheless, the validator can still suppress issue reporting for checks defined # in inherited profiles by setting disable_inherited_profiles_issue_reporting to `True`. enable_profile_inheritance: bool = True # Validation settings #: Flag to abort on first error abort_on_first: bool | None = False #: Flag to disable reporting of issues related to inherited profiles disable_inherited_profiles_issue_reporting: bool = False #: Flag to disable remote crate download disable_remote_crate_download: bool = True # Requirement settings #: The requirement severity requirement_severity: str | Severity = Severity.REQUIRED #: Flag to validate requirement severity only skipping check with lower or higher severity requirement_severity_only: bool = False # Requirement check settings #: Flag to allow requirement check override allow_requirement_check_override: bool = True #: Flag to disable the check for duplicates disable_check_for_duplicates: bool = False #: Checks to skip skip_checks: list[str] | None = None #: Flag to validate only the metadata of the RO-Crate metadata_only: bool = False #: RO-Crate metadata as dictionary metadata_dict: dict | None = None #: Verbose output verbose: bool = False #: Cache max age in seconds (negative values mean "never expire") cache_max_age: int = DEFAULT_HTTP_CACHE_MAX_AGE #: Cache path cache_path: Path | None = None #: Flag to enable offline mode: HTTP requests are served only from the cache offline: bool = False #: Flag to disable the HTTP cache entirely: every request hits the network no_cache: bool = False #: Flag to indicate validation at creation time creation_time: bool = False #: Flag to enforce availability checks regardless of creation time enforce_availability: bool = False #: Flag to skip availability checks skip_availability_check: bool = False def __post_init__(self): # if requirement_severity is a str, convert to Severity if isinstance(self.requirement_severity, str): self.requirement_severity = Severity[self.requirement_severity] # Offline mode needs the cache to serve responses, so it cannot be # combined with an explicit cache disable. if self.offline and self.no_cache: raise ValueError( "Offline mode requires the HTTP cache to be enabled; no_cache=True is incompatible with offline=True." ) # Default to the persistent user cache whenever caching is enabled so that # consecutive runs (online then offline) share the same HTTP cache: this # is what lets the offline mode find the resources fetched online. if self.cache_path is None and not self.no_cache: default_path = get_default_http_cache_path() default_path.parent.mkdir(parents=True, exist_ok=True) self.cache_path = default_path logger.debug("Cache path not set: defaulting to persistent user cache %s", self.cache_path) if self.offline and self.cache_path is None: logger.warning( "Offline mode enabled without a persistent cache path: " "all HTTP-backed resources will fail unless pre-populated." ) # Re-apply the cache settings to the HTTP requester. ``initialize_cache`` # reconfigures the existing singleton in place (rather than dropping it), # so new settings take effect without discarding state set on the instance. HttpRequester.initialize_cache( cache_path=str(self.cache_path) if self.cache_path is not None else None, cache_max_age=self.cache_max_age, offline=self.offline, no_cache=self.no_cache, ) logger.debug( "HTTP cache initialized at %s with max age %s seconds (offline=%s, no_cache=%s)", self.cache_path, self.cache_max_age, self.offline, self.no_cache, ) # Install the JSON-LD document loader so context resolution goes through the cache. try: install_document_loader() except Exception as e: logger.debug("Could not install JSON-LD document loader: %s", e) # Best-effort synchronous warm-up of profile-declared URLs. if not self.offline: try: auto_warm_up_for_settings(self) except Exception as e: logger.debug("Auto warm-up skipped: %s", e)
